What is PEDEVCO's operating lease right-of-use asset amortization?
PEDEVCO (PED) reported operating lease right-of-use asset amortization of $48K in Q1 2026.
How has PEDEVCO's operating lease right-of-use asset amortization changed year-over-year?
PEDEVCO's operating lease right-of-use asset amortization increased by 71.4% year-over-year, from $28K to $48K.
What is the long-term trend for PEDEVCO's operating lease right-of-use asset amortization?
Over 2 years (2023 to 2025), PEDEVCO's operating lease right-of-use asset amortization has grown at a 30.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$100K to $170K.
